WebApr 6, 2024 · One familiar type of samara is the double-winged one found on maple trees ( Acer spp. ). Ash trees ( Fraxinus spp.) produce a samara that features a single elongated wing. Elm trees ( Ulmus spp.) produce samaras where the seed is located in the middle of a papery circle. Here are 11 trees and shrubs that produce helicopter seeds. WebApr 16, 2024 · Promote healthy growth by watering the sycamore during dry periods. Apply about 10 gallons of water per week when rainfall is lacking during the summer months. Watering should be around the base, soaking the soil well and avoiding standing water. It is vital not to water fast, which allows the soil to absorb it better.
